Output 397401d945fba59f5bbfca54052ec643b4e8dab7e07ee6459268eebbeb33270d:0

value
16429858
script pubkey
OP_0 OP_PUSHBYTES_20 be34fbdcc46a0aab776e249fb61fbdafed82c762
address
bc1qhc60hhxydg92kamwyj0mv8aa4lkc93mz0gpcvj
transaction
397401d945fba59f5bbfca54052ec643b4e8dab7e07ee6459268eebbeb33270d
confirmations
680
spent
true